    Hi Fro,

    The space available will determine when words start wrapping onto 2 lines. If the sub menu type is a mega menu, you can increase the width of the column that the link is within. If the sub menu type is a flyout menu, you can increase the width of the flyout menu in the theme editor.

    For the second question, it is your theme that determines the position of the menu, so if there is no theme option to change the position of the menu, you’d need some custom CSS to change its position. If you could post a link to your site I would be happy to advise.
